Description
Upon entering the property, you enter the extended porch with hall, leading to two generously sized reception rooms the dining room then leads out into a substantial conservatory overlooking the beautiful garden, perfect for both unwinding and entertaining guests. The fitted kitchen comes complete with built-in electric oven and hob with access into the utility and garage. The first floor of the home features four well-appointed bedrooms, master with en-suite and family bathroom.
Externally this property doesn't disappoint, as it benefits from a well-maintained mature garden perfect for summertime barbecues and entertaining or having your morning coffee in the tranquillity of your own private side garden. Tucked away at the top of the cul-de-sac property offers ample parking for multiple cars and has an attached garage for additional parking.
Situated in Forest Hall, a vibrant community in Newcastle upon Tyne, this property benefits from great transport links, numerous shopping facilities, local schools, and pleasing green spaces. It's an excellent opportunity for those looking to put down roots in a delightful location whilst still being within easy reach of the city's conveniences.
